What is a Vacuum Robot?
A vacuum robot, also referred to as a robotic vacuum or robovac, is an automated cleaning device designed to navigate and clean floors in homes and workplaces. Equipped with sophisticated sensing units, navigation systems, and cleaning innovations, these robots can draw up a space, prevent barriers, and clean efficiently without human intervention. They are generally small, circular, and can fit under furnishings and in tight areas, making them perfect for a variety of environments.
Key Features of Vacuum Robots
Autonomous Navigation
Mapping and Path Planning: Modern vacuum robots use sophisticated algorithms and sensing units to develop a comprehensive map of the environment. This enables them to plan effective cleaning paths and avoid barriers.Obstacle Detection: Sensors like infrared, ultrasonic, and video cameras assist the robot discover and navigate around furnishings, walls, and other barriers.Cliff Detection: To avoid falls, these robotics are equipped with sensing units that discover edges and drop-offs, ensuring they remain on the floor.
Cleaning Capabilities
Suction Power: Vacuum robotics come with varying levels of suction power, ideal for various kinds of floorings and debris.Brushes and Mop Attachments: Many designs include side brushes and primary brushes to remove and gather dirt, in addition to mopping attachments for damp cleaning.HEPA Filters: High-efficiency particle air (HEPA) filters are typically consisted of to catch great particles and irritants, enhancing indoor air quality.
Connectivity and Control
Smart Home Integration: Most vacuum robots can be integrated with smart home systems like Amazon Alexa, Google Assistant, and Apple HomeKit, enabling voice control and scheduling.Mobile App Control: Users can manage and monitor their vacuum robots using dedicated mobile apps, which use features like remote start, cleaning schedules, and cleaning history.
Battery Life and Charging
Long Battery Life: Modern vacuum robots can run for several hours on a single charge, depending on the model.Automatic Recharging: When the battery is low, the robot can go back to its charging dock autonomously and resume cleaning once completely charged.Benefits of Vacuum Robots

Are vacuum robots appropriate for all types of floorings?
Yes, most vacuum robots are designed to tidy various floor types, including wood, tile, and carpet. Nevertheless, it's crucial to check the specs of the model to guarantee it is suitable for your particular floor type.
How frequently should I clean up the filter and brushes?
It is suggested to clean the filter and brushes after each usage to keep optimal efficiency. For HEPA filters, cleaning as soon as a month is usually adequate.
Can vacuum robots tidy stairs?
Many vacuum robotics are not developed to clean stairs due to security issues and the threat of falling. However, some designs might have features that permit them to clean up the edges of stairs.
Are vacuum robotics loud?
While vacuum robotics are generally quieter than standard vacuums, the noise level can differ depending on the design. The majority of modern designs are created to operate at a low sound level, making them suitable for use throughout the day or night.
Can I utilize a vacuum robot with animals?
Yes, vacuum robots are frequently recommended for homes with family pets due to their capability to clean up pet hair and dander efficiently. Some models even include specialized pet hair brushes.
